Home
last modified time | relevance | path

Searched refs:VariantKind (Results 1 – 24 of 24) sorted by relevance

/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/MCTargetDesc/
H A DAMDGPUMCExpr.h32 enum VariantKind { enum
56 VariantKind Kind;
61 AMDGPUMCExpr(VariantKind Kind, ArrayRef<const MCExpr *> Args, MCContext &Ctx);
71 create(VariantKind Kind, ArrayRef<const MCExpr *> Args, MCContext &Ctx);
75 return create(VariantKind::AGVK_Or, Args, Ctx); in createOr()
80 return create(VariantKind::AGVK_Max, Args, Ctx); in createMax()
93 return create(VariantKind::AGVK_AlignTo, {Value, Align}, Ctx); in createAlignTo()
102 VariantKind getKind() const { return Kind; } in getKind()
H A DAMDGPUMCExpr.cpp26 AMDGPUMCExpr::AMDGPUMCExpr(VariantKind Kind, ArrayRef<const MCExpr *> Args, in AMDGPUMCExpr()
45 const AMDGPUMCExpr *AMDGPUMCExpr::create(VariantKind Kind, in create()
87 static int64_t op(AMDGPUMCExpr::VariantKind Kind, int64_t Arg1, int64_t Arg2) { in op()
493 case AMDGPUMCExpr::VariantKind::AGVK_Or: { in targetOpKnownBitsMapHelper()
503 case AMDGPUMCExpr::VariantKind::AGVK_Max: { in targetOpKnownBitsMapHelper()
513 case AMDGPUMCExpr::VariantKind::AGVK_ExtraSGPRs: in targetOpKnownBitsMapHelper()
514 case AMDGPUMCExpr::VariantKind::AGVK_TotalNumVGPRs: in targetOpKnownBitsMapHelper()
515 case AMDGPUMCExpr::VariantKind::AGVK_AlignTo: in targetOpKnownBitsMapHelper()
516 case AMDGPUMCExpr::VariantKind::AGVK_Occupancy: { in targetOpKnownBitsMapHelper()
/freebsd/contrib/llvm-project/llvm/lib/Target/NVPTX/
H A DNVPTXMCExpr.h22 enum VariantKind { enum
31 const VariantKind Kind;
34 explicit NVPTXFloatMCExpr(VariantKind Kind, APFloat Flt) in NVPTXFloatMCExpr()
41 static const NVPTXFloatMCExpr *create(VariantKind Kind, const APFloat &Flt,
69 VariantKind getKind() const { return Kind; } in getKind()
H A DNVPTXMCExpr.cpp20 NVPTXFloatMCExpr::create(VariantKind Kind, const APFloat &Flt, MCContext &Ctx) { in create()
/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/MCTargetDesc/
H A DARMMachORelocationInfo.cpp24 unsigned VariantKind) override { in createExprForCAPIVariantKind() argument
25 switch(VariantKind) { in createExprForCAPIVariantKind()
32 VariantKind); in createExprForCAPIVariantKind()
/freebsd/contrib/llvm-project/llvm/lib/MC/MCDisassembler/
H A DMCRelocationInfo.cpp21 unsigned VariantKind) { in createExprForCAPIVariantKind() argument
22 if (VariantKind != LLVMDisassembler_VariantKind_None) in createExprForCAPIVariantKind()
H A DMCExternalSymbolizer.cpp135 Expr = RelInfo->createExprForCAPIVariantKind(Expr, SymbolicOp.VariantKind); in tryAddingSymbolicOperand()
/freebsd/contrib/llvm-project/llvm/include/llvm/MC/MCDisassembler/
H A DMCRelocationInfo.h41 unsigned VariantKind);
/freebsd/contrib/llvm-project/llvm/include/llvm-c/
H A DDisassemblerTypes.h82 uint64_t VariantKind; member
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/MCTargetDesc/
H A DHexagonMCExpr.h17 enum VariantKind : uint8_t { enum
H A DHexagonMCCodeEmitter.h81 HexagonMCExpr::VariantKind Kind) const;
H A DHexagonELFObjectWriter.cpp44 auto Variant = HexagonMCExpr::VariantKind(Target.getSpecifier()); in getRelocType()
H A DHexagonMCCodeEmitter.cpp492 HexagonMCExpr::VariantKind VarKind) const { in getFixupNoBits()
649 auto VarKind = HexagonMCExpr::VariantKind(MCSRE->getSpecifier()); in getExprOpValue()
/freebsd/contrib/llvm-project/llvm/include/llvm/MC/
H A DMCExpr.h197 enum VariantKind : uint16_t { enum
232 VariantKind getKind() const { return VariantKind(getSubclassData()); } in getKind()
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DAMDGPUMCResourceInfo.h53 AMDGPUMCExpr::VariantKind Kind,
H A DAMDGPUMCResourceInfo.cpp165 if (TargetExpr->getKind() == AMDGPUMCExpr::VariantKind::AGVK_Max) { in flattenedCycleMax()
181 int64_t LocalValue, ResourceInfoKind RIK, AMDGPUMCExpr::VariantKind Kind, in assignResourceInfoExpr()
/freebsd/contrib/llvm-project/llvm/lib/Target/SystemZ/MCTargetDesc/
H A DSystemZMCObjectWriter.cpp
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/
H A DHexagonMCInstLower.cpp47 HexagonMCExpr::VariantKind RelocationType; in GetSymbolRef()
/freebsd/contrib/llvm-project/llvm/lib/Target/AArch64/Disassembler/
H A DAArch64ExternalSymbolizer.cpp173 auto Spec = getMachOSpecifier(SymbolicOp.VariantKind); in tryAddingSymbolicOperand()
/freebsd/contrib/llvm-project/llvm/lib/MC/
H A DMCExpr.cpp93 const MCSymbolRefExpr::VariantKind Kind = SRE.getKind(); in print()
/freebsd/contrib/llvm-project/llvm/tools/llvm-objdump/
H A DMachODump.cpp3072 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M_HI16; in SymbolizerGetOpInfo()
3075 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M_LO16; in SymbolizerGetOpInfo()
3107 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M_HI16; in SymbolizerGetOpInfo()
3109 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M_LO16; in SymbolizerGetOpInfo()
3131 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M_HI16; in SymbolizerGetOpInfo()
3133 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M_LO16; in SymbolizerGetOpInfo()
3190 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M64_PAGE; in SymbolizerGetOpInfo()
3194 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M64_PAGEOFF; in SymbolizerGetOpInfo()
3198 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M64_GOTPAGE; in SymbolizerGetOpInfo()
3202 op_info->VariantKind = LLVMDisassembler_VariantKind_ARM64_GOTPAGEOFF; in SymbolizerGetOpInfo()
[all …]
/freebsd/contrib/llvm-project/llvm/lib/Target/Hexagon/AsmParser/
H A DHexagonAsmParser.cpp1260 switch (HexagonMCExpr::VariantKind(Value.getSpecifier())) { in parseInstruction()
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/AsmParser/
H A DAMDGPUAsmParser.cpp8883 using AGVK = AMDGPUMCExpr::VariantKind; in parsePrimaryExpr()
/freebsd/contrib/llvm-project/llvm/include/llvm/Testing/Demangle/
H A DDemangleTestCases.inc14111 …NS_6MCExprERNS_9MCContextE", "llvm::ARMMCExpr::Create(llvm::ARMMCExpr::VariantKind, llvm::MCExpr c…
15972 …espace)::AsmParser::ApplyModifierToExpr(llvm::MCExpr const*, llvm::MCSymbolRefExpr::VariantKind)"},
23072 …_11VariantKindE", "llvm::MCSymbolRefExpr::getVariantKindName(llvm::MCSymbolRefExpr::VariantKind)"},
23077 …:MCSymbolRefExpr::Create(llvm::MCSymbol const*, llvm::MCSymbolRefExpr::VariantKind, llvm::MCContex…
23078 …"llvm::MCSymbolRefExpr::Create(llvm::StringRef, llvm::MCSymbolRefExpr::VariantKind, llvm::MCContex…